The 1N5236B-T Zener diode, with its breakdown voltage of 3.6V, is a versatile component in electronic circuits, particularly in multivibrator applications. Multivibrators are essential for generating square waves and pulse signals, which are fundamental in timing, oscillation, and signal generation.
